Join us as we discover the perfect gear to accompany you on your next adventure. Shelter When you find yourself in a survival situation, having adequate shelter is crucial. Tents are an excellent choice as they provide protection from the elements while being lightweight and portable. Look for tents that are easy to set up and take down, making them ideal for emergency situations. In addition to tents, emergency blankets are another essential item to have in your survival gear. These blankets are compact and lightweight, making them easy to carry in your backpack. They are designed to reflect your body heat back to you, helping to maintain your body temperature in cold conditions. Emergency blankets are also waterproof and windproof, providing an extra layer of protection against the elements. Water Access to clean drinking water is essential for survival. In a survival situation, you may not always have access to a clean water source. This is where water filters come in handy. Look for portable water filters that are lightweight and easy to use. These filters can remove harmful bacteria and parasites from natural water sources, making it safe to drink. To carry your filtered water, portable water containers are a must-have. Look for containers that are durable and leak-proof. Opt for collapsible water containers as they are easy to store and take up less space in your backpack. These containers are also lightweight, allowing you to carry an adequate amount of water without adding too much extra weight. Food In a survival situation, having access to food can be difficult. Meal replacement bars are a convenient and compact option to keep you nourished while on the go. These bars are typically packed with essential nutrients and calories, providing you with the energy you need to survive. Look for bars that are specifically designed for survival situations, as they are often formulated to provide a balanced meal. Dehydrated meals are another excellent food option for survival situations. These meals are lightweight and have a long shelf life, making them perfect for emergency situations. Dehydrated meals only require boiling water to rehydrate, making them easy to prepare. Look for meals that offer a variety of flavors and are packed with essential nutrients to keep you fueled and satisfied. Fire Fire is not only crucial for warmth, but it can also be used for cooking food and purifying water. A lightweight stove is an essential item to have in your survival gear. Look for stoves that are compact and can be easily packed away. These stoves are designed to be fuel-efficient, allowing you to use minimal resources while still having a reliable source of heat and cooking. To start a fire, having a reliable firestarter is essential. Look for firestarters that are lightweight and easy to use. Options like magnesium fire starters or waterproof matches are excellent choices as they can withstand various weather conditions. Always ensure you have multiple firestarters in your pack to ensure you can start a fire when needed. Navigation Knowing where you are and how to navigate your surroundings is crucial in a survival situation. A compass is a simple yet effective tool that everyone should have in their survival gear. Look for a compass that is durable and accurate. Familiarize yourself with how to use a compass before heading into the wild to ensure you can navigate properly. While a compass is a reliable tool, having a GPS device can provide additional benefits. GPS devices are compact and can be easily carried in your backpack. These devices can provide valuable information such as your exact coordinates, elevation, and even topographic maps. Look for GPS devices that are rugged and have long battery life to ensure they are suitable for survival situations. Lighting Having a reliable source of lighting is crucial, especially during nighttime or in low-light situations. A headlamp is an excellent choice as it allows you to keep your hands free while providing adequate illumination. Look for headlamps that are lightweight and comfortable to wear. Consider headlamps with adjustable brightness levels and different light modes for versatility. In addition to a headlamp, carrying a mini flashlight is always a good idea. Mini flashlights are compact and can easily fit in your pocket or backpack. Look for flashlights that are durable and have a long battery life. Consider features such as adjustable focus or multiple light modes to suit different situations. First Aid In a survival situation, injuries can happen, and having a well-equipped first aid kit is essential. Look for compact first aid kits that contain the essentials such as bandages, antiseptics, and pain relief medication. These kits should also include items like tweezers, scissors, and adhesive tape. Ensure your first aid kit is lightweight and waterproof to protect the contents from any unforeseen circumstances. CPR face shields are another crucial item to have in your first aid kit. These shields can protect you from potential pathogens while performing CPR on someone in need. Look for CPR face shields that are compact and individually packaged for easy storage and accessibility. Tools Having versatile tools in your survival gear can greatly increase your chances of survival. A multi-tool is a must-have item as it combines various tools in one compact device. Look for a multi-tool that includes features such as pliers, a knife, screwdrivers, and a saw. These tools can be invaluable for a wide range of tasks in a survival situation. Along with a multi-tool, carrying a pocket knife is always a good idea. Pocket knives are compact and can be easily carried in your pocket or attached to your backpack. Look for a knife that has a sharp blade and a durable handle. Consider features such as a built-in firestarter or a serrated edge for additional functionalities. Communication Being able to communicate with the outside world in a survival situation is crucial. A portable radio is an excellent choice as it allows you to listen to emergency broadcasts or contact nearby rescuers. Look for radios that are compact and have a long battery life. Consider radios that include features such as weather alerts or a built-in flashlight for added functionality. In addition to a radio, carrying a signal mirror is recommended. Signal mirrors can be used to reflect sunlight and attract attention from rescuers or passing aircraft. Look for signal mirrors that are lightweight and durable. Ensure the mirror has a sighting hole to aid in aiming the reflection precisely. Miscellaneous There are a few miscellaneous items that can come in handy in a survival situation. Paracord is a versatile tool that can be used for a wide range of purposes such as building a shelter, securing gear, or creating makeshift tools. Look for paracord that is lightweight and has a high weight-bearing capacity. Consider getting paracord that has built-in features such as a firestarter or a whistle for added functionality. Duct tape is another useful item to have in your survival gear. Duct tape can be used for repairs, securing items, or creating makeshift gear. Look for duct tape that is compact and easy to carry.
